Gringo Star take you out to their ballgame in the video for the title track from their new album “Back to the City.” The Atlanta quartet plays the Hi Hat on Sept. 19.

Thursday’s things: ► L.A. quintet Fool’s Gold [pictured below] celebrate the release of their new album “Flying Lessons,” the band’s third full-length, with a show at the Troubadour. The Happy Hollows and Line & Circle support. ► U.K. singer-songwriter James Bay visits the Fonda Theatre behind his debut album “Chaos and the Calm,” with Elle […]
